In a move that has sent shockwaves through the media landscape, Tim Davie, the Director-General of the BBC, has tendered his resignation following a tumultuous week marked by scathing criticism over the broadcaster's decision to edit a speech by former U.S. President Donald Trump. The controversy has reignited the long-standing debate about the role of public broadcasters, their accountability to taxpayers, and the importance of upholding free speech and journalistic integrity in a democratic society.

The BBC, which has long been accused of harboring a left-leaning bias, found itself in the crosshairs of conservatives after it chose to censor parts of President Trump's speech. This decision was met with swift condemnation from Trump's press secretary, who labeled the broadcaster as "100% fake news." The incident has once again highlighted the dangers of media outlets, especially those funded by public money, pushing a partisan agenda and undermining the principles of objective reporting.

As a publicly funded institution, the BBC has a duty to remain impartial and represent the diverse views of its audience. However, the recent controversy has cast serious doubts on its ability to fulfill this mandate. The selective editing of President Trump's speech raises concerns about the BBC's commitment to free speech and its willingness to manipulate the truth to suit a particular narrative. Such actions not only erode public trust in the media but also undermine the very foundations of our democratic system.
